我正在尝试从故事板中特定配置UIPageViewController:

TutorialPageViewController.h
#import <UIKit/UIKit.h>
@interface TutorialPageViewController : UIPageViewController <UIPageViewControllerDelegate, UIPageViewControllerDataSource>
@end
Run Code Online (Sandbox Code Playgroud)
TutorialPageViewController.m
#import "TutorialPageViewController.h"
@interface TutorialPageViewController ()
@property (assign, nonatomic) NSInteger index;
@end
@implementation TutorialPageViewController
{
NSArray *myViewControllers;
}
- (id)initWithNibName:(NSString *)nibNameOrNil bundle:(NSBundle *)nibBundleOrNil
{
self = [super initWithNibName:nibNameOrNil bundle:nibBundleOrNil];
if (self) {
// Custom initialization
}
return self;
}
- (void)viewDidLoad
{
[super viewDidLoad];
// Do any additional setup after loading the view.
self.delegate = self;
self.dataSource = self;
[self didMoveToParentViewController:self];
UIStoryboard *tutorialStoryboard = [UIStoryboard storyboardWithName:@"TutorialStoryboard" bundle:[NSBundle mainBundle]];
UIViewController …Run Code Online (Sandbox Code Playgroud) 我用谷歌搜索但没有找到答案.所以我需要问一下.我有一个主屏幕.当用户登录时,它将显示一个视图,如下图所示
现在,当用户退出并访问主页时,他将看到上面的布局,但没有中心框的布局.如果我将该布局设置为隐藏,则它现在显示如下.

我想将第三个布局移到上面一点点以移除空白区域..
我使用故事板添加了约束.现在需要从编程中删除约束并添加一个约束,将布局设置为低于第一个布局.
我更新到Xcode 6.1来修复我使用Interface Builder Cocoa Touch Tool时出现的错误,当我使用故事板时,它会占用99%的CPU,这会冻结Xcode.既然错误得到解决,我可能会遇到更令人沮丧的错误.
当我使用故事板时,我正在处理一个UIViewController,我的UITextView,我的自定义UITextViews(它们是UITextView故事板中的所有意图和目的的子类,它们都是UITextViews),然后我UIImageView突然消失了!
以下是我的视图控制器中的默认主视图现在的样子:
主视图
故事板中有一个UILabel设置,允许设置自动缩小配置,如下所示:
但我无法为UIButton的文本标签找到相同的内容.我知道我可以通过编程方式设置它,但很想知道是否有办法在Storyboard中为UIButton启用此设置.
我想知道有没有办法以编程方式检索特定的高度约束UIView并在代码中更改其值?我有一种情况,我有几个UIViews有四个边缘固定在IB和高度限制添加(IB抱怨,如果我没有),但在程序的中间我需要改变的高度,UIViews并导致一些UIViews被推在视图中向下.
我知道我可以按住Ctrl +拖动每个的高度限制UIViews并在代码中更改它们的值,但这样做需要我连接其中的几十个.所以我认为这样做效率不高,而且在某种程度上无法扩展.
所以我想知道有没有办法通过代码完全检索特定视图的高度约束并动态更改它?
谢谢!
我经常遇到这个问题,我希望我的观点以一种方式排列为纵向,而对于景观则有一种截然不同的方式.
有关简化示例,请考虑以下事项:


请注意,在纵向上图像是垂直堆叠的,但在横向上,它们是并排的?
当然,我可以手动计算位置和大小,但对于更复杂的视图,这很快就会变得复杂.另外,我更喜欢使用Autolayout,因此设备特定的代码更少(如果有的话).但这似乎要写很多 Autolayout代码.有没有办法通过故事板为这类东西设置约束?
我用Google搜索了两个单词,却找不到任何东西.我从来没用过它.虽然我们有main.storyboard,但有没有必要呢.
我正在寻找一个热键,例如spacebar+ Click 'n drag,这将使我能够使用鼠标来平移Xcode Storyboard.
显然我可以使用鼠标滚轮来平移故事板,但是单击并将其拖动到我想要的确切位置会更加繁琐.
有没有办法通过点击并拖动动作来平移Xcode故事板?
我有最新版本的Xcode.在我的一个项目中,我注意到iPhone的视图是新的iPhone 5屏幕尺寸.我喜欢它,但有没有办法切换回较小的屏幕尺寸?不是每个人都拥有iPhone 5.
Xcode storyboard助理编辑停止显示相关文件.选择"自动"并在Identity Inspector中填写"类".
它以前工作过,但知道它已经停止了.除了StoryBoard之外,"Auto"或"CounterPart"模式仍在为其他文件而烦恼.
几天前,我尝试从Xcode 5更新到6,但后来放弃了.这会与它有关吗?
xcode-storyboard ×10
ios ×7
xcode ×3
iphone ×2
autolayout ×1
ios6 ×1
ios8 ×1
iphone-5 ×1
mouse ×1
objective-c ×1
pan ×1
uiimageview ×1
uikit ×1
uistoryboard ×1
uitextview ×1
xcode4.5 ×1
xcode6 ×1